Scribble Maps Salary

As of April 2026, the average annual salary for employees at Scribble Maps in the United States is $84,627. This translates to an approximate hourly wage of $41. Salaries at Scribble Maps typically range from $74,564 to $95,478 annually,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company.

What Is the Cost of Living Near Davenport?

Understanding the cost of living near Davenport is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Scribble Maps.
Davenport's Cost of Living Index is approximately 78.3 (21.7% less expensive than US average; 13.0% less than IA average). Quad Cities area (IA/IL), very affordable housing. CitiBus. When planning your budget based on a salary from Scribble Maps,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$700 - $1,100+ A significant portion of Scribble Maps sal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$150 - $240 (Seasonal swings)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$30 (CitiBus mon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$350 - $520 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$280 - $550+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$330 - $620+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$1,840 - $3,030+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
